Essendon midfielder Jake Melksham suffered a broken hand on Friday, completing a horrific week for the besieged AFL club.
A teammate accidentally kicked Melksham during their intra-club match.
But coach James Hird was confident the injury would not interrupt the 21-year-old's pre-season.
"Jake will have the operation today but he will be back into training on Monday," Hird told the club website.
"We look forward to him playing in the next two to three weeks."
The Bombers are under an anti-doping investigation after they went to the league earlier this week with concerns about supplements their players took last season.
